Please note the 'Zane Grey' Bio advertised on the Cover.
For those who haven't got past the cheesecake on the covers of the CAVALCADE mags, allow me to point 0ut that these were published during the WW2 years and contain many articles and photographs of the war. Some of the photographs are astonishing. And the advertising throughout is priceless.

Well WWII had been over for 10yrs when this issue went to press, but yes as I looked at these prior to uploading, the 1941-1945  issues are pretty gritty. There are also a lot of short/quick reads of crime stories in these too. Both fiction and (allegedly) non-fiction. The main appeal for me in this title is the span from the late 1940's to about 1954 when the issues each contained a short comic story, always very ably drawn by Phil Belbin.
